The Sandman
Netflix

This show is a triumph. It is brilliantly cast, looks astounding and is reliably faithful to its source material. I really enjoyed every aspect of this (although the David Thewlis episode was kinda bleak) and carefully rationed out the episodes to get maximum enjoyment.
In particular I want to call out the first 20 minutes of “The Sound of Her Wings” - this is possibly some of the best television you will ever see. A masterclass in writing, story telling and acting. There are no special effects, no big dramatic scenes but for heart, compassion and the importance of living well it is unsurpassed. I could watch this again and again.
